Overview
- On August 1, 2025, McGregor officially registered his first UFC Anti-Doping test of the year.
- USADA regulations require fighters to spend at least six months in the testing pool before being eligible to fight.
- UFC president Dana White is scheduled to meet McGregor in Italy to negotiate the details of his comeback fight.
- McGregor has expressed interest in the proposed UFC White House event set for July 2026, timed with the nation’s 250th anniversary.
- He shared photos on social media of his blood and urine sampling, underscoring his fitness and fueling fan anticipation.
